Access'te Rapor dizaynı için bir yöntem..

Katılım
30 Ocak 2006
Mesajlar
937
Excel Vers. ve Dili
Access 2003
Arkadaşlar, bu gönderdiğim dosya bir access veri tabanında ne varsa hepsini düzenleme işini yapmaya yarayan bir dosya... Ben bunu fatura programımda kullanmak istiyorum ve böylece kullanıcının kitlenmiş bir access dosyasında faturasını access'in rapor dizayn özelliğini kullanarak düzenlemesini amaçlıyorum. Fakat program Rapor düğmesine basınca veri tabanındaki tüm raporları gösteriyor. Oysa bir şekilde sadece fatura, tahsilat makbuzu vb gibi raporlara müdahale etmesini istiyorum. Yani kullanıcıya tüm raporları göstermek istemiyorum. Bu dosya ile bunu sağlamam mümkün mü?
 
Katılım
15 Kasım 2006
Mesajlar
583
Excel Vers. ve Dili
Ms Office 2003 Türkçe
kullanıcı dediğine göre bir kullanıcılar tablon var demekki.

bu kullanıcılara ait bir de kullanacağı raporlar, moduller, ...
isimlerinin tutulduğu bir tablo daha yapıcan.

ve
Public Function SetListBox(ObjectType As Integer)
içinde kullanıdığın select cümlelerini bu tablo ile eşleştirerek
getiricen.

şimdilik aklıma başka bişey gelmiyor.
 
Katılım
30 Ocak 2006
Mesajlar
937
Excel Vers. ve Dili
Access 2003
Kodları değiştirip sadece adlarını yazdığım raporların açılması sağlanamaz mı ?.. Yani şu şu raporları göster diyerek diğerlerini yok sayması mümkün olmaz mı?
 
Katılım
15 Kasım 2006
Mesajlar
583
Excel Vers. ve Dili
Ms Office 2003 Türkçe
yukarıda yazdığım da bu söylediğinizle aynı şey zaten.
 
Katılım
30 Ocak 2006
Mesajlar
937
Excel Vers. ve Dili
Access 2003
Sandığınız gibi bir kullanıcı tanım dosyası yok. Programda satış faturası ve tahsilat makbuzu rapor şeklinde.. Ama kullanıcının kendi dizayn ettiği ve matbaada bastırdığı bir faturası ve matbuu Tah. Mak. varsa o zaman benim programı açık hale getirip Shift ile girip dizaynı yapmam falan gerek. Oysa bu dosya Shift kapalı da olsa, access gizlenmiş de olsa -buna emin değilim ama sanırım- raporun dizayn edilmesini sağlıyor. Oysa programda alt raporlar ve sabit raporlar gibi yaklaşık 40 rapor var. Raporlar düğmesine basılınca da tümü görünür ve tasarlanabilir hale geliyor. İşte bu aşamada ben "bu projedeki tüm raporları göster" anlamına gelen kodu değiştirip "sadece şu ve şu raporları göster" diye isteğimi programa gömmek istiyorum. Yapmak istediğim bu.. Eğer hala aynı şeyi söylediğinizi düşünüyorsanız özür dilerim ama ben anlayamadım o zaman. Bir küçük örnekle açıklar mısınız?
 
Katılım
15 Kasım 2006
Mesajlar
583
Excel Vers. ve Dili
Ms Office 2003 Türkçe
kullanıcının....

diyorsun ya,

bu kullanıcı, açılışta kul adı, şifre girerek mi programı açıyor?
 
Katılım
30 Ocak 2006
Mesajlar
937
Excel Vers. ve Dili
Access 2003
:)) Yok yok.. Kullanıcı dediğim programımın kullanıcısını kastediyorum.. Yanlış anlaşıldı galiba..
 
Katılım
30 Ocak 2006
Mesajlar
937
Excel Vers. ve Dili
Access 2003
Zaten böyle bir durumun olması ya da olmamsı yapmak istediğimizi engellemez ki. Eğer bazı raporları bu şekilde açmasını engelleyebiliyorsak zaten iş olmuş demektir. Herkes için geçerli olsun önemli değil.
 
Katılım
15 Kasım 2006
Mesajlar
583
Excel Vers. ve Dili
Ms Office 2003 Türkçe
yani, zorla yaptırtıyorsunuz :)

bir tablo eklendi. bu tabloya, görünmesi istenen raporların isimleri eklendi.

formda, rapor butonuna basınca kullanılan strSQL sorgusu, yeni tablo ile join yapar hale hetirildi.

bu mudur?

(dosyanın soyismi zip değil 7z)
 
Katılım
30 Ocak 2006
Mesajlar
937
Excel Vers. ve Dili
Access 2003
Evet işte bu.. Kodları incelemedim o yüzden nasıl yaptığınız ile ilgili yorum yapamıyorum ama çok teşekkürler.. Evet İşte böyle zorla yaptırıyoruz :))).. Aslında şu daha önce birlikte uğraştığımız cariextre ile ilgili birşeye takıldım. Onunla bu geceden beri uğraşıyorum. Şu önceki tarih olayı..
 
Katılım
2 Eylül 2005
Mesajlar
3
zipli dosya alınmıyor

merhaba bende bu konuyla ilgileniyorum
uygulamayı almak istedim alamadım
linki bozuk herhalde
zipli dosyayı ekleyebilirmisiniz.

saygılar
 

assenucler

Altın Üye
Katılım
19 Ağustos 2004
Mesajlar
3,552
Excel Vers. ve Dili
Ofis 365 TR 64 Windows 11 Home Single Language x64 TR
Altın Üyelik Bitiş Tarihi
29-05-2025
Sitede yaşanan teknik bir sorun nedeniyle 31.12.2008 tarihinden önceki dosyalar silinmiştir.
 

akd

Destek Ekibi
Destek Ekibi
Katılım
14 Ağustos 2004
Mesajlar
1,114
Excel Vers. ve Dili
2003
Yönetici arkadaşlara sesleniyorum,
cevap niteligindeki ekleri olmayan konuları silseler,
arkadaşlar boşu boşuna umutlanmaz ve yorulmazlar.
İyi çalışmalar...
 
Katılım
6 Şubat 2005
Mesajlar
1,467
Evet yanlışlıkla pdf dosyası eklemişim. Yukardaki ek dosyayı değiştirdim. Sorun "Ciddiyet" ten kaynaklanmıyor. :)
 
Üst